A Course On Environment Art From Gnomon

Are looking for a course on environment art? Here is a great introduction to game scenes from Gnomon.

Student work by Evan Cwiertny

“This course presents students with the techniques currently used in game production to create complex real-time environments,” states the description. “Course lecture topics cover building modular assets on a grid, sculpting tiled textures, and set dressing. Proficiencies highlighted in the class include scene composition and efficiency, modeling and sculpting, baking and transferring maps, creating textures and materials, and level assembly.”

You will learn skills through homework assignments and then develop a final portfolio piece for presentation and critique. The 10-week course is led by Nate Stephens and Raul Aparicio who are true masters of environment design. You will learn a number of tricks in Maya, Marmoset Toolbag, and ZBrush.
